CHA Consulting, Inc. is currently seeking a Principal Scientist to join our Power & Manufacturing – Environmental Team working remotely in Oregon.  

YOUR IMPACT

CHA’s engineers, ecologists and scientists partner with clients to develop practical solutions that strike the right balance between environmental sustainability, community needs and cost. We’re uniquely qualified to assist with environmental services from initial site characterization through remediation.  CHA draws on the expertise of technical professionals with decades of practical experience in environmental site assessment, brownfield remediation, and mitigation techniques.

 

The Principal Scientist is responsible for leading the technical execution of major projects including planning, scheduling, conducting, and coordinating detailed phases of major projects. This key role will lead scientific teams working on multiple assignments, varying in size and complexity, and ensure compliance with standard operating procedures as well as laboratory policies. The professional in this role serves as a technical expert in their discipline, performing technical reviews of analytical data and methods and directing operational improvements as well as promoting innovation through the evaluation of new analytical techniques.

 

The Principal Scientist interacts with project management and other function teams, reporting findings to clients and company leadership as required. This individual develops relationships with current clients and assists business development in the preparation of proposals. Additionally, the Principal Scientist will complete field assignments as required.

REQUIREMENTS

  • Bachelor’s Degree in Environmental Science or related field
  • Minimum of 15 years of related, progressive technical and management experience required
  • Valid US driver’s license required
  • Proficiency with ArcMap or basic GIS Mapping required
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Word & Excel is required
  • Excellent interpersonal and leadership skills
  • Strong ability to work in a team environment
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ills
  • Has proficient theoretical scientific knowledge
  • Demonstrates and promotes a positive attitude toward position, group, and company
  • License/certification in technical discipline is preferred 

SALARY RANGE:

$104,000 - $132,500

 

Salary is based on a variety of factors, including, but not limited to, qualifications, experience, education, licenses, specialty, training, and fair market evaluation based on industry standards.
